Bottlenecks are resolution-dependent. At 1440p the renderer hands more pixels to the RTX 5090, so it stays the busy part and CPU headroom grows. Watch GPU usage in an overlay: if the RTX 5090 sits at 97-99% while frames are steady, the GPU is the limiter and the pairing is healthy. If GPU usage dips into the 70s while frame-time spikes, the Ryzen 7 9700X is the part asking for help, usually in physics-heavy or large-scale scenes.
Beyond the two headline parts, the supporting cast decides whether you actually see clean frames. Run dual-channel DDR5-6000 (32GB is the sane gaming default now), keep storage on an NVMe SSD so texture streaming never stutters, and make sure case airflow keeps the RTX 5090 under thermal throttle during long sessions.
